'Fresh Food Thursday' Offers Produce To Seniors in Glen Burnie

Residents age 60 and older or those 18 and older with a disability can pick up a box of produce on Thursdays at the Pascal Senior Center.

GLEN BURNIE, MD —Anne Arundel County's department of aging and disabilities has teamed up with the Anne Arundel County Food Bank to present Fresh Food Thursday to residents age 60 and older or anyone age 18 and older with a disability. Participants will receive a free box of fresh produce on a first-come, first-served basis.

The boxes will be handed out at the Pascal Senior Center located at 125 Dorsey Road on May 20, June 3 and June 17. For more information, contact the department at 410-222-0256 or senior_nutrition@aacounty.org.
